Checklist — Image Slimming (Torvald Platform). Confirm multi-stage build strips compilers and test fixtures. Final image must be under 180 MB. Run the layer scan; zero orphaned caches allowed. Smoke-test the slim image in staging before tagging. Don't publish until the scan report is green. The build token for the approved image follows below.

session token of yajof-bagef = htk4_937d

## Authentication

The Wrenbury CSV import wizard authenticates against the Saltmere ingestion gateway before any rows are parsed. Release managers should confirm the credential is scoped to the target environment, since staging and production keys are not interchangeable and mismatches fail silently during dry runs. For the current release train, the gateway accepts the key shown below.

API key for yahig-tadup: kto7_ubizbYm

Reverted planner defaults after last week's regression. Join reordering heuristic introduced in 8.1.0 caused pathological plans on wide fact tables; p95 latency tripled on the Varnholt cluster. Root cause: new cardinality estimator underestimates correlated predicates. Fix: estimator disabled by default, old cost model restored. Teams that opted into the new planner via override flags should remove them — the override now silently no-ops. Full postmortem next sync. Current production planner configuration is below.

service settings:
[oliix]
team = noveth
access_code = ac_4de949
host = oliix.novachq.corp
port = 8080
owner = wenir.casion
peer = wenys.lumicstack.corp

// Crash reports from the Pebbleflight mobile apps get shipped to our
// internal Smashcatch pipeline. Heads up for release managers: symbolication
// only works if the build's dSYMs were uploaded first, so don't skip that
// step or you'll be staring at raw addresses all night. The client below
// talks straight to the ingest endpoint, so it needs the key right here.

gateway credential: kto3_qfe

Hey all — quick heads up for folks new to Mossline: the checkout handlers are cold-starting slowly again after yesterday's runtime bump. We've re-enabled the warmer pool, so p99 should settle by tonight. No action needed, just don't panic at the graphs. The affected deploy is identified by the token below.

pipeline stamp: htk31_f769b577b3028a4e9958e5bb8d1259a